The biggest purchase in the budget for your household is the purchase of a home and car. Payments and interest payments on those items are probably going to make up the bulk of your expense each month. You can reduce the amount of interest that you pay by increasing your monthly payment.

Put money in your savings account every month by setting up a direct transfer from checking to savings. This method makes it a requirement for you to save some of your money every month. It is also a great way to save for an important future event, such as a special vacation or a wedding.

Try negotiating with debt collectors who are trying to get you to make payments. They most likely bought your debt from the originating company at a discount. They will make a profit even if you do not pay a percentage of your debt. Use this to your advantage when paying off old debt.

Student loan debt has fewer consumer protections than other kinds of debt, so make absolutely sure that you can repay any student loan debt you accrue. Attending an expensive school for a major you’re unsure of may put you into serious debt.
